There are five meetings taking place this afternoon with flat cards from Royal Ascot, Thirsk, Beverley and Brighton as well as a jumps card from Stratford.  It is top hat and tails for David as he is off to Royal Ascot with Percy Street who runs in the 2m4f Ascot Stakes at 5.00pm.  Looking through the field, there are no less than eleven jumps trainers who have a runner, while Willie Mullins is mob handed with five runners.  Percy Street is making his debut for the stable this afternoon and is taking a big step up in trip - he was a quality animal on the flat but this is a big ask.  If I had to have a bet I would probably side with Coeur de Lion who looks as though he has further room for improvement with this longer trip.

Royal Ascot will be split between two channels this afternoon as the Poland versus Senegal match is also on.  The 4½ hour show gets underway at 1.30pm on ITV and runs on that channel until 3.25pm and then switches to ITV4 where it continues until 6pm.  Does it get any better than that?

Will the Americans take the money back to the States in the Group One King's Stand Stakes at 3.40pm?  Lady Aurelia, winner of the race last year tries to defend her title although I think that Battaash can win this so long as he gets out of the stalls okay.  It should be a thrilling race but don't blink or you will miss it!
